MCC’s voice is personable. It’s not complicated or overwhelming. Instead, it’s clear, friendly, and helpful. At times, it’s inspirational without being over the top.
It’s for real people looking to engage, connect, find community, and participate in God’s work. So it’s accessible and sincere.
Personality Traits
We are…
Engaging but not edgy
Welcoming but not pushy
Helpful but not patronizing
Focused but not rigid
Challenging but not demanding
Hopeful but not unbelievable
Practical but not boring
Inspiring but not showy
Match personality traits to the content you're writing. What trait should come through on your section or page? Do you need to be more engaging and inspirational? Is it best to be practical and helpful?
Point of View
At MCC, we use plural, first-person language (we, us). This creates a conversational feel and allows us to talk directly to our audience.
Like this: We listen for what God's doing in our neighborhood. And then we find meaningful ways to join His work.
Not this: MCC is focused on listening for what God's doing in the neighborhood.
Go through each page and make sure your content is first person and conversational (we, us, our, you your).
